Cost of Slab Jacking in Dover, FL
Slab jacking is a technique used to lift and stabilize uneven concrete slabs, often to correct sinking or settling issues. In Dover, FL, the cost of slab jacking can vary depending on the scope of the project, the materials used, labor requirements, and site conditions. These factors influence the final pricing, making it important to obtain detailed assessments for accurate estimates.
Typical expenses for slab jacking in Dover, FL, are influenced by the size of the area, accessibility, and the extent of underlying soil conditions. Since project costs can differ significantly based on these variables, it is recommended to compare multiple quotes and consider the specific needs of each site when evaluating options. Final pricing will be determined after an on-site evaluation and assessment of all relevant factors.
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,500 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Residential Slab Leveling |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Commercial Slab Leveling | $3,500 - $7,500 |
| Driveway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Patio Leveling |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Sidewalk Leveling |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Garage Floor Leveling |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Slab jacking is a method used to lift and stabilize uneven or sunken concrete slabs, commonly applied to driveways, walkways, and patios in Dover, FL. This technique involves raising the existing concrete without complete removal, making it a practical solution for addressing settling issues and restoring level surfaces. Understanding the typical scope and considerations of slab jacking projects can help in planning and comparison.
- Materials: Typically utilizes polyurethane foam or mud slurry to lift and stabilize the slab.
- Size and Scope: Suitable for small to large areas, often ranging from a few square feet to several hundred square feet.
- Labor Complexity: Generally involves specialized equipment and techniques, requiring skilled labor for proper application.
- Permitting: Usually does not require extensive permits in Dover, FL, but local regulations should be verified beforehand.
- Extras: Additional services may include surface repairs, sealing, or waterproofing to enhance longevity.
Project Size and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small area repair (e.g., porch or walkway) | $500 - $2,500 |
| Moderate section (e.g., garage slab) |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Large slab or multiple areas | $6,000 - $15,000 |
| Extensive foundation stabilization | $15,000 and up |
In Dover, FL, project costs for slab jacking can vary based on the size and scope of the area to be lifted and stabilized.
